The Job: On behalf of our client, we are seeking a Recoveries Department Manager. In this role you will lead and manage the Recoveries function, driving cost effective debt recovery and minimising company loss. You will manage a team of Recoveries Specialists and oversee processes that maximise funds recovered across the portfolio, including joint venture activities.
Responsibilities will include:
- Lead and manage team performance, modelling the behaviours required to achieve department KPIs.
- Ensure effective training, development and individual coaching of Recoveries Specialists, building a succession plan for future business needs.
- Monitor, enhance and adapt the Recoveries strategy and processes in line with trends identified through internal and external data sources.
- Collaborate with and challenge approved external collection agencies, tracing agents and solicitors to deliver effective, value for money services in line with agreed statements of work.
- Ensure appropriate metrics and reporting are in place to measure and manage third party performance.
- Embed and maintain a caseload monitoring process to ensure recoveries activities are conducted effectively and consistently across the team.
- Project manage and progress higher value and more complex arrears and recovery cases.
- Lead the provisioning process in line with policy and in collaboration with other departments, implementing the write off policy and ensuring effective reporting.
- Complete required controls and audits to confirm adherence to regulatory and procedural requirements, taking prompt action where risks are identified.
- Create clear and insightful reporting packs for formal committees.
The Person: The ideal candidate is a proactive, hands-on leader with strong people-management skills and a deep understanding of collections and recoveries within a regulated environment. They are seeking someone who has:
- Proven experience leading a team in a collections or recoveries environment.
- Demonstrated ability to manage complex recoveries activities and drive performance against KPIs.
- Strong understanding of legal processes and regulatory requirements relating to non-performing loans.
- Ability to build strong customer relationships and manage third-party service providers.
- Confident analysing data and reviews to inform strategy and improve recovery outcomes.
